![]() ![]() ![]() ![]() ![]() ![]() ![]() |
Your WebLogic Real Time software cannot be used without a valid license. When you install your software, the installation program installs an expiring production license (license.bea
) into the BEA_HOME/jrockit-realtime20_XXX/jre/ directory, to allow you to start using the product immediately.
The following sections explain how to acquire, install, and update your product licenses:
BEA products use an XML-format license file called license.bea
. In WebLogic Server environments, this license file is stored in the BEA Home directory and is used for the BEA products installed in that directory. Your BEA software checks this file at run time to determine which product components you are authorized to use.
For WebLogic Real Time, access to the JRockit Deterministic GC option and JRA tool require an additional license key in the license.bea file in the JRockit /jre directory. For instructions on updating this license, see Manually Updating Your BEA JRockit License.
Note: | See the End-User License Agreement for specific license terms and conditions. |
When you install WebLogic Real Time, an expiring production license file (license.bea
) is installed on your system. By default, your software uses the evaluation production license installed with the product so that you can start using it immediately.
The technical restrictions that WebLogic Real Time production license file imposes are:
http://www.bea.com
.Note: | The license.bea file conforms to the XML grammar definition. The XML definition (<?xml version="1.0" encoding="UTF-8"?> ) must be at the very beginning of the license.bea file. There cannot be any spaces or line breaks before the XML definition. |
When you install WebLogic Real Time, the installation program generates an expiring 60-day evaluation license.bea
file for use with the software and installs it in the BEA_HOME/jrockit-realtime20_XXX/jre/ directory.
In some cases, however, you must update the license.bea
file separately, independent of the installation process. For example, you must update your license file if at least one of the following is true:
In each of these cases, you will receive a new license file from BEA, the contents of which must be included in the license.bea
file in the BEA_HOME/jrockit-realtime20_XXX/jre/ directory.
To allow you to start using the product immediately, the installers installs an evaluation JRockit R27.3 production license (license.bea
) with Deterministic GC and JRA keys, into the BEA_HOME/jrockit-realtime20_XXX/jre/ directory. However, after 60 days, this evaluation license must be replaced with non-expiring JRockit R27.3 production license.
These steps explain how to update the evaluation JRockit license file with a non-expiring JRockit R27.3 production license:
BEA_HOME/jrockit-realtime20_XXX/jre/
WARNING: | If you already have a JRockit Mission Control license, you should make a backup copy before overwriting it with the Deterministic GC and JRA tool license. |
license.bea
, thus, the full path to the license should be:BEA_HOME/jrockit-realtime20_XXX/jre/license.bea
-Xgcprio:deterministic
option from a Java command line.startRealTime
(.cmd/.sh
), to see how to start BEA JRockit with Deterministic GC enabled.Note: | Follow steps 2-4 when updating the BEA JRockit license with either a WebLogic Real Time 2.0 CD-ROM kit evaluation production license or a WebLogic Real Time 2.0 non-expiring production license obtained from BEA. |
The format of the license.bea
file changes with each release of WebLogic Real Time software. To upgrade a license.bea
file from a previous release to a license for the current release, complete the following steps:
http://elicense.bea.com
.Note: | You need a BEA eLicense account to log in to this Web site. If you do not have a BEA eLicense account, click the Register link on the Customer Support site to register for one. |
You will receive an upgraded license file through e-mail. To update the license.bea
file on your system, see Manually Updating Your BEA JRockit License.
![]() ![]() ![]() |